Has an NBA game ever ended 72-59?
Yes. NBA has seen a final score of 72-59 3 times. It first happened on January 12, 1947, when St. Louis Bombers beat Pittsburgh Ironmen, and most recently on December 23, 1952, when Indianapolis Olympians beat Ft. Wayne Zollner Pistons.
That makes 72-59 the 2018th most common final score out of 3,189 that have ever occurred in NBA. One point away, 73-59 has happened never and 72-60 has happened 3 times.
